On CSA Form 1099R the Taxable amount is lower than the Gross distribution. Why does TurboTax not enter the lower Taxable amount on the total income section?

Gross Distributions :   17628.00
Taxable amount:           16993.80
Difference:                          634.20

On CSA Form 1099R the Taxable amount is lower than the Gross distribution. Why does TurboTax not enter the lower Taxable amount on the total income section?

TurboTax is not listing your TAXABLE income, it is just a picture of what money came in for you for 2023. 

 

You can look at your 1040 to see what is being reported on line 5a (total) and 5b (Taxable) 

 

To View

For TurboTax Desktop, switch to Forms (top right) 

 

TurboTax Online:

Select Tax Tools on the left side-bar

Select Tools from that drop-down

Select “View Tax Summary” on the TOOLS CENTER screen

Select “Preview my 1040” which now appears on the left side-bar
